Job DescriptionCNC Manufacturing Process Programmer (Multi‑Axis)

Imagine launching a new implant component: you architect the process, choose the fixturing, map out multi‑axis strategies in CAD/CAM, and then stand at the machine to verify every move. The result? Reliable, efficient programs that keep our mission of Life Unlimited moving.

Your impact

  • Author and maintain advanced multi‑axis CNC programs with CAD/CAM to manufacture precision parts.
  • Define the machining process—chucking/fixturing, tool selection and layout, and feeds/speeds—driving standardization and tool life.
  • Lead machine‑side prove‑outs and validate programs for release.
  • Write clear work instructions; supervise machining process validations and train operators.
  • Collaborate with Manufacturing Engineering, Product Development Engineering, plant teams, and external partners to solve problems and deliver on schedule.
  • Safeguard program integrity by managing the master CNC program directory with strict file management.
  • Deliver and report on cost‑saving improvements.
  • Plan, coordinate, and assign programming tasks to fellow programmers when required.
  • Contribute to the design of jigs, tools, fixtures, and special‑purpose CNC equipment.
  • Maintain and promote current CNC programming standards.
  • Recommend new equipment to enhance capability and throughput.
  • Follow programming file management procedures and applicable Quality Specifications to ensure QMS compliance.
  • Mentor programmers and machinists as a recognized authority.
  • Drive cross‑functional improvements and kaizen initiatives.

Qualifications

  • High school diploma or equivalent required; college/technical degree preferred.
  • At least 5 years of CNC programming experience, including 3+ years using CAD/CAM.
  • Required expertise: Unigraphics for multi‑axis milling and PartMaker for multi‑axis lathe programming.
  • Ability to adapt to normal scheduling and urgent needs to keep parts flowing; work may arise from on‑the‑shop‑floor opportunities.
  • Excellent documentation skills and clear verbal communication.
  • Strong math skills, including trigonometry, and the analytical ability to resolve shop challenges.
  • Physical requirements: walking and standing about 50% of the time; bending, squatting, and reaching about 10%.
  • Bonus: Prior machinist experience.
